What a krait can jump 57 ly? I take it that is heavily engineered? I only just bought one for combat and have been having fun with it.

Yep, engineering galore on Prometheus. Increased FSD range to the max, lightweight life support, no weapons. stripped down modules as much as I could, plus Guardian FSD Booster. I was carrying a fighter bay, I've dumped that and gained 2Ly.
